ICOSL, also known as B7-H2, is a glycosylated transmembrane structure, which belongs to the immunoglobulin superfamily and BTN/MOG family. ICOSL could play an important role in mediating local tissue responses to inflammatory conditions, as well as in modulating the secondary immune response by co-stimulating memory T-cell function.
